On offer: updated tuning tests that I believe are easier to use#42
Open
cwm9cwm9 wants to merge 1 commit intoPedro-Pathing:masterfrom
Open
On offer: updated tuning tests that I believe are easier to use#42cwm9cwm9 wants to merge 1 commit intoPedro-Pathing:masterfrom
cwm9cwm9 wants to merge 1 commit intoPedro-Pathing:masterfrom
Conversation
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
Add this suggestion to a batch that can be applied as a single commit.This suggestion is invalid because no changes were made to the code.Suggestions cannot be applied while the pull request is closed.Suggestions cannot be applied while viewing a subset of changes.Only one suggestion per line can be applied in a batch.Add this suggestion to a batch that can be applied as a single commit.Applying suggestions on deleted lines is not supported.You must change the existing code in this line in order to create a valid suggestion.Outdated suggestions cannot be applied.This suggestion has been applied or marked resolved.Suggestions cannot be applied from pending reviews.Suggestions cannot be applied on multi-line comments.Suggestions cannot be applied while the pull request is queued to merge.Suggestion cannot be applied right now. Please check back later.
This modification contains multiple changes to the tuning opmodes.
The following opmodes have been modified: TranslationalTuner, HeadingTuner, DriveTuner, Line, CentripetalTuner
The all the opmodes, except CentripetalTuner, have been modified so that dpad left/right initiates appropriate motion for the opmode in question. dpad up/down modifies the distance the test travels through. The path constraints have been modified so path following does not end in order to be able to observe end of travel behavior better.
The CentripetalTuner has had the path constraints modified so path following does not end, and the timeout increased so there is a delay between the forward and backward paths.
These changes make it much easier to tune the robot, because you can see how the robot responds to small changes as well as large changes, and because you can see the end behavior more clearly since a return path is not immediately taken.